Ordinals
beta
Address 13NQmYQTDHpimfzxg3qy8ia6jTYHEVRqiS
sat balance
308514
outputs
ad75784773064d59b7b7124006e045a027d77a8b294c9f22f0e3be82ef99851b:1
fec8759471487ad834581c54f65767d98ead88186127cf11bfa35d37c47c852a:1
4a61e4923612811da8bac218322323cf364a3f6ae3011eb3af3d998de45ddcde:1
dc9f9f14b8114cc3e6ce90891698d1f8ee727a9a8b38de7144d8661bf263c7e5:0